PRELIMINARY COMPETITION
STAGE ONE THROUGH STAGE THREE
 Stage One through Stage Three function based on a three group structure that spans all three stages.
 Each of the three groups is comprised of 4 sub-groups each.
STAGE ONE
 The 23 PMAs ranked 13 to 35 constitute the 23 Stage One teams.
 The stage consists of 12 sub-groups played as 11 home-and-away series and one bye, St. Vincent and the
Grenadines.
 The winners and St. Vincent and the Grenadines advance to Stage Two and meet the highest ranked
teams in their respective groups.

STAGE TWO
 The 11 Stage One series winners and St. Vincent and the Grenadines will then play the remaining teams
in their respective sub-groups in Stage Two.
 The 24 teams will be paired into 12 home-and-away series.
 The winners advance to Stage Three.

STAGE THREE
 The 12 sub-group winners from Stages One and Two will then contest Stage Three.
 Teams will be grouped into 3 round-robin, home-and-away groups of 4 teams.
 The group winners and runners-up advance to Stage Four.

STAGE FOUR
 The three Stage Three group winners and 3 Stage Three group runners-up will contest Stage Four.
 The six teams will form 1 round-robin, home-and-away group.
The top 3 teams qualify for the FIFA World CupTM.
The 4th placed team enters a home-and-away playoff with the 5th placed South American team.

PRELIMINARY DRAW
STAGE TO BE DRAWN
 Stages One, Two and Three will be drawn at the Preliminary Draw in Durban, South Africa.

DRAW FORMAT
 For Stages One, Two and Three, the 35 teams are divided into 6 pots based on the FIFA/Coca-Cola World
Ranking of May 2007 with the strongest teams in Pot A, the next strongest teams in Pot B and so on
though to Pot F.
o Pots A and B have 3 teams each
o Pot C has 6 teams
o Pot D has 1 team
o Pots E and F have 11 teams each
o Special Pot W will contain 11 “winner” balls for the Stage Two draw
 Stage One: Teams from Pots E and F will be drawn into 11 home-and-away series.
 Stage Two: The 11 Stage One winners (Pot W) and the team from Pot D will be drawn against teams
from Pots A, B, and C into 12 home-and-away series.
 Stage Three: The three Stage Three groups are automatically determined by the winners of the 12 subgroups.
